Tejas Mk1A Production Pipeline Gains Momentum with Engine Deliveries

Hindustan Aeronautics Limited (HAL) has made significant progress in its production pipeline for the Tejas Mk1A aircraft, with the receipt of 10 engines from General Electric (GE). This development is expected to enable HAL to deliver 10 aircraft to the Indian Air Force by the end of March.

According to Ravi Kumar, Chairman and Managing Director of HAL, the company has received 10 engines, which will be utilized to complete 10 LCA Mk1A aircraft for delivery by March. This is a crucial milestone in the production pipeline, as it allows HAL to move forward with the final assembly and delivery of the aircraft.

The statement from Ravi Kumar also indicates that GE has committed to delivering another 12 engines by December. These engines will provide additional propulsion sets for Tejas Mk1A aircraft that have been built in various stages of production. The timely delivery of these engines is critical, as it will enable HAL to complete the aircraft and meet the delivery schedule.

It is worth noting that HAL had previously mentioned that more than 20 Tejas Mk1A jets are ready and have completed flights, but are currently in storage. However, the company has not provided a clear explanation for why it is limiting the delivery of these aircraft to 10 units by March, despite the availability of additional engines.

The production pipeline for the Tejas Mk1A aircraft is complex, and the availability of engines and other major systems is critical to its success. Any slippage in engine delivery could affect the final assembly and aircraft handover schedule.
